If I don't select Force Bayer CFA then my OSC RGB FITS never get debayered.  However, I tried a multi-filter, multi session calibration and integration with some OSC RGB subs (camer ASI294mc pro) and some Ha subs (ASI1600mm pro).  First I forgot to select Force Debayer and of course nothing came out colour.  Then I selected Force Debayer and the RGB master came out colour...but so did the Ha even though it's mono/no bayer.

Questions: 1. why doesn't APP recognise my OSC subs and debayer automatically without selecting Force debayer - is there some other setting I need to apply?  2. If I do select Force debayer, why does APP apply it to subs that I've selected as Ha?  (I presume because APP is forced to debayer everything if it's selected)
